diff options
author | Brian Norris <computersforpeace@gmail.com> | 2012-02-21 10:38:43 -0800 |
---|---|---|
committer | Jeff Garzik <jgarzik@redhat.com> | 2012-03-13 16:35:47 -0400 |
commit | 55d5ec316627b64c3764e4c1b4b8e1988e272c1f (patch) | |
tree | 02143de94a97d4c56c94d30acf7f544ec233ed15 /drivers/ata/ahci.h | |
parent | 66583c9fa63d05d5580e409f9a58d3cad6d76d17 (diff) | |
download | op-kernel-dev-55d5ec316627b64c3764e4c1b4b8e1988e272c1f.zip op-kernel-dev-55d5ec316627b64c3764e4c1b4b8e1988e272c1f.tar.gz |
ahci: move AHCI_HFLAGS() macro to ahci.h
We will need this macro in both ahci.c and ahci_platform.c, so just move it
to the header.
Signed-off-by: Brian Norris <computersforpeace@gmail.com>
Signed-off-by: Jeff Garzik <jgarzik@redhat.com>
Cc: stable@kernel.org
Diffstat (limited to 'drivers/ata/ahci.h')
-rw-r--r-- | drivers/ata/ahci.h |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/drivers/ata/ahci.h b/drivers/ata/ahci.h index feb127e..c2594dd 100644 --- a/drivers/ata/ahci.h +++ b/drivers/ata/ahci.h @@ -195,6 +195,9 @@ enum { PORT_FBS_EN = (1 << 0), /* Enable FBS */ /* hpriv->flags bits */ + +#define AHCI_HFLAGS(flags) .private_data = (void *)(flags) + AHCI_HFLAG_NO_NCQ = (1 << 0), AHCI_HFLAG_IGN_IRQ_IF_ERR = (1 << 1), /* ignore IRQ_IF_ERR */ AHCI_HFLAG_IGN_SERR_INTERNAL = (1 << 2), /* ignore SERR_INTERNAL */ |